Synopsys Non-Volatile Memory (NVM) IP offers One-Time Programmable (OTP), Few-Time Programmable (FTP) and Multi-Time Programmable (MTP) NVM solutions for code storage, configuration, calibration, and security across a wide range of applications—automotive, industrial and consumer. For applications requiring enhanced protection, the Secure Storage Solution for OTP IP adds dedicated hardware-level security.
Supporting densities from 16 bits to 1 Mbit, Synopsys NVM IP is available in standard CMOS, BCD, HV, embedded flash, and specialty processes—without extra masks or process steps, enabling cost‑efficient integration and broad foundry availability.
Engineered for high performance, low power, and reliability, the IP supports endurance up to 1,000,000 cycles, high‑temperature operation for automotive environments, and meets AEC‑Q100 Grades 0, 1, and 2 on select nodes. Each NVM instance undergoes comprehensive characterization, JEDEC/JESD qualification, and reliability testing. With antifuse OTP technology and availability from 180 nm to advanced nodes, Synopsys NVM IP is silicon‑proven in thousands of designs.
Optimized architectures and configurations ensure strong PPA and manufacturability, making Synopsys NVM IP a secure, scalable, and robust solution for modern SoCs.
Synopsys advanced node OTP is silicon-verified in TSMC's N7, N6, N5, N5A, N4P, and N3P processes. Synopsys OTP in TSMC N5A is Grade 1 qualified to the AEC-Q100 standard.
Non-volatile memory retains data even when power is removed, making it essential for storing configuration settings, security keys, firmware, and other critical information. One-time programmable (OTP) NVM provides non-volatile storage that supports power, form factor, and security requirements for a variety of use cases, including code storage, encryption keys, analog trimming, and IC configuration. Synopsys NVM OTP is preferred for advanced FinFET nodes because it offers high scalability, security, and is crucial for first-pass silicon success, especially when using antifuse technology. While thinner oxides in advanced nodes pose challenges, Synopsys OTP IP solutions are designed to be reliable across various conditions for securely storing critical data like encryption keys, device IDs, analog trimming and IC configuration.
